Specialist SEN Teacher - Autism Focus

Are you a passionate and qualified Teacher with experience supporting students with Special Educational Needs (SEN), particularly Autism Spectrum Disorder (ASD)? We are seeking dedicated educators to join our specialist school for pupils with autism.

We are looking for teachers who bring creativity, enthusiasm, and expertise to our unique and supportive learning environment. The ideal candidate will be committed to helping every student reach their full potential through tailored and empathetic teaching approaches.

Josh of Aspire People is seeking a full time and part time SEN Teacher to support pupils with high needs and different pathways of Autism and moderate health disabilities; these include pre-verbal, ADHD, Severe anxiety, sensory processing difficulties and epilepsy.
